フィールドの値を使った値一覧を任意の順番で表示する(10分でスキルアップ)

複合 インデックス 順番

という順番で付けるのが妥当そうな気もします。 ですが実は、そう単純なものではありません。 複合Indexの場合、必ずしもカーディナリティ順でなくても良い 今回のテーブルの場合、 code と category は複合ユニークです。 Q:じゃあ複合インデックスって? 複数の並び替え条件でインデックスを作ること。 例えば、所属コードと社員コードでインデックスを作った場合 社員テーブル(インデックス:所属コード,社員コード) テーブルの複数の列に対して一つのインデックスを作成したものを「複合インデックス」、「連結インデックス」などと言います。. インデックスに指定する列の順番には意味があり、基本的には先頭列をカーディナリティが高くてWhere句で検索する 複合インデックスを張る際の注意点としては、列の順番である。 複合インデックスを定義する際に考えるべき最も重要なのは、そのインデックスを使えるSQL文ができるだけ多くなるように、 列の順番を決めることです。 【デッドロック/複合インデックスの順番/よくある間違いなど】 2023年10月29日. 開発を行う上でデータベース(DB)とSQLはとても身近なものです。 一方その仕組みは複雑で、様々な種類のDBがありますが似て非なる動作をするDBの仕様を混同している人は少なくなく、 SNSでSQLの間違った情報を広めて炎上するエンジニアなども定期的に出ます。 そこで今回はMySQL InnoDBについて、開発を行っている人が知っておくとよいことをまとめることにしました。 MySQL InnoDBを使った開発を行っている人が対象です。 できる限り公式のソースを併記するようにしています。 他のDBでも共通していることも多いですが、MySQL以外でどうなのかはあまり触れていないのでご留意ください。 |aii| lmy| bmi| qlr| yio| tdz| odi| pap| zdn| xia| emu| ive| rkv| int| vbb| qka| epe| vaw| tcd| syx| dkk| khl| rsx| qby| ofd| qgf| dtz| vgp| lye| xij| jte| zib| eyp| hjp| rgo| uen| fvd| zkw| kda| emu| dic| akw| noz| lup| uzu| sbm| xbb| nzv| fyr| sxk|